Sangarida Pico Tuerto 2022


From the renowned Tempranillo-based Riojas to the bold Garnacha wines of Priorat, Spain is known for producing red wines that balance power, complexity and elegance. Sangarida Pico Tuerto is no exception. Made by brothers Robustiano and Baldomero Fariña, Sangarida is a daring project that champions the rare, native grapes of Spain’s Bierzo region.
Following the family tradition and history of Attis Bodegas y Viñedos, the Fariña brothers have expanded their philosophy of championing Spain’s rare, native grapes. Together with their longtime friend Jean-François Hébrard, they embarked on a new project, named Sangarida, in Bierzo.
Pico Tuerto is named after one of the most important peaks in the Aquilianos Mountains. It’s made using old-vine Mencía grapes grown in the San Lorenzo area, sheltered by Pico Tuerto, and aged for 12 months in French oak barrels. It’s brimming with ripe red and black fruit, oak spice and mineral hints, with a velvety texture and impressive complexity. Enjoy this wine alongside red meats, hearty stews, venison or aged cheeses.
